Pierce County has a vast history of flood protection work that began in the 1850s. Early catastrophic flooding and flood diversion projects changed our river systems into what they are today. WebNov 15, 2024 · The Skagit River is at "major" flood stage this afternoon and is forecasted to crest at over 37.5 feet Tuesday morning, which would break the all-time record of 37.4 feet set in 1990.
